Pure Storage FlashBlade-Erkennung
Die ServiceNow Discovery-Anwendung verwendet das FlashBlade Pure Storage-Muster, um FlashBlade-Komponenten zu finden. Um einige dieser Ressourcen zu erkennen, muss aktualisiert werden Muster für Discovery und Service-Mapping Anwendung aus dem ServiceNow Store.
Discovery kann Pure Storage FlashBlade Version 4 erkennen.
Hinweis:
Nur Linux MID Servers Werden für die Pure Storage FlashBlade-Discovery unterstützt. Windows MID Servers Werden nicht unterstützt.
Apps im Store anfordern
Besuchen Sie die ServiceNow Store-Website, um alle verfügbaren Apps anzuzeigen und Informationen zum Senden von Anforderungen an den Store zu erhalten. Kumulative Informationen zum Release für alle veröffentlichten Apps finden Sie in den Release-Hinweisen zum ServiceNow Store-Versionsverlauf.
Voraussetzungen
- Konfigurieren Sie Anwenderberechtigungen für UNIX BETRIEBSSYSTEM
- Konfigurieren Sie einen Anwender für den Zugriff auf UNIX BETRIEBSSYSTEM.
- Definieren Sie den BS-Anwender mit Berechtigungen zum Ausführen der folgenden Befehle.
Befehl Parameter Obligatorisch/Optional Beschreibung Pureman - Obligatorisch Greift auf die Liste der Pure Storage-Befehle zu und verwendet sie für die Klassifizierung Echo $$username$$ Obligatorisch Füllt den Benutzernamen für die temporäre Variable aus "pureadmin list " + $usr + " --api-token --expose --csv" Obligatorisch Ruft das Benutzer-API-Token ab, um die x-auth für die REST-Aufrufbefehle zu generieren. -
Definieren Sie den BS-Anwender mit den erforderlichen Berechtigungen zum Ausführen der folgenden REST API-Aufrufe.
/api/login– Ruft den x-auth-Token-Leser aus der Antwort in Groovy ab./api/1,2/file – Systeme– Ruft Informationen zu den Dateisystemen ab./api/1,2/Blades– Ruft Informationen zu Blades ab./api/1,2/dns– Ruft Informationen zu DNS ab./api/1,2/Hardware– Ruft Informationen zur Speicherhardware ab./api/1,4/Network-interface– Ruft Informationen zu Netzwerkschnittstellen ab.
- Definieren Sie den BS-Anwender mit Berechtigungen zum Ausführen der folgenden Befehle.
- Konfigurieren Sie SSH-Anmeldeinformationen
- Auf der ServiceNow AI Platform, Konfigurieren Sie SSH-Anmeldeinformationen für den BS-Anwender. Weitere Informationen finden Sie unter SSH credentials.
- Konfigurieren Sie anwendbare Anmeldeinformationen
- Auf der ServiceNow AI Platform, Konfigurieren Sie anwendbare Anmeldeinformationen für den BS-Anwender. Das Passwortfeld ist nicht relevant. Sie können einen beliebigen Wert für das Passwort eingeben oder es leer lassen. Weitere Informationen finden Sie unter Applicative credentials.
- Zugriff auf den für REST-Aufrufe verwendeten Port
- Auf relevant Linux MID Servers, Gewähren Sie einem Anwender Zugriff auf den Port, der für REST-Aufrufe verwendet wird.
Daten erfasst von Discovery Für Pure Storage FlashBlade
Discovery Füllt die Daten in aus CMDB Beim Ausführen des FlashBlade Pure Storage-Musters.
| Tabelle und Feld | Beschreibung |
|---|---|
| Speicherserver [cmdb_ci_storage_server] | Die von FileShare for PureBlade bereitgestellten Attribute des Speicherservers |
| IP-Adresse [ip_address] | |
| Seriennummer [serial_number] | |
| Name [name] | |
| Pure Storage-Prozessor [cmdb_ci_storage_processor_pure] | Die Attribute des PureBlade-Speicherprozessors |
| Name [name] | |
| Seriennummer [serial_number] | |
| Geräte-ID [device_id] | |
| Modellnummer [model_number] | |
| Seriell [serial] | |
| Steckplatz [slot] | |
| Typ [type] | |
| Status [status] | |
| Pure Storage-Dateifreigabe [cmdb_ci_storage_fileshare_pure] | Die Attribute des FileShare-Speichers |
| Name [name] | |
| Pfad [path] | |
| Protokolle [protocols] | |
| Bereitgestellter Speicherplatz [provisioned_space] | |
| Eindeutiger Speicherplatz [unique_space] | |
| Snapshots-Speicherplatz [snapshots_space] | |
| Gesamter physischer Speicherplatz [total_physical_space] | |
| Freigegebener Speicherplatz [shared_space] | |
| Datenreduktion [data_reduction] | |
| Systemspeicherplatz [system_space] | |
| Speichergerät [cmdb_ci_storage_device] | Die Attribute des im Speicherserver enthaltenen Speichergeräts. |
| Geräte-ID [device_id] | |
| Name [name] | |
| Seriennummer [serial_number] | |
| Modellnummer [model_number] | |
| Speichertyp [storage_type] |
Die Grafik stellt CIs dar, die Teil der FlashBlade-Erkennung sind.

CI-Beziehungen
Discovery Erstellt diese Beziehungen zur Unterstützung der Pure Storage FlashBlade-Discovery.
| CI | Beziehung | CI |
|---|---|---|
| Pure Storage-Dateifreigabe [cmdb_ci_storage_fileshare_pure] | Bereitgestellt von::Stellt bereit | Speicherserver [cmdb_ci_storage_server] |
| Speichergerät [cmdb_ci_storage_device] | Enthält::Enthalten in | Speicherserver [cmdb_ci_storage_server] |
| Speicherserver [cmdb_ci_storage_server] | Enthält::Enthalten in | Pure Storage-Prozessor [cmdb_ci_storage_processor_pure] |